Why Mulch Is a Must-Have for Your Garden
Mulch is more than just a finishing touch. When used properly, it:
✅ Retains soil moisture by reducing evaporation
✅ Suppresses weeds by blocking sunlight
✅ Improves soil health as it breaks down
✅ Regulates soil temperature — keeping roots cooler in summer and warmer in spring/fall
✅ Protects against erosion from heavy rain and runoff
✅ Adds curb appeal with a polished, uniform look
💡 Fun Fact: Organic mulch (like shredded bark or wood chips) improves your soil structure over time — making every season better than the last.
When to Mulch in Ontario (Timing Is Everything)
Applying mulch at the right time is key to maximizing its benefits.
✔️ Best Time to Mulch in Spring:
- Late April to mid-May — once the soil has warmed up (around 10°C / 50°F)
- After spring clean-up and before new weeds begin to take over
🚫 Avoid mulching too early:
- Cold soil + mulch can delay plant growth
- Wet soil can lead to fungal or root issues if sealed off too soon
Choosing the Right Mulch for Your Garden
There are two main categories of mulch to consider:
Mulch Type | Best For | Pros | Considerations |
---|---|---|---|
Organic Mulch | Flower beds, trees, veggie gardens | Adds nutrients, improves soil over time | Needs refreshing annually |
e.g. wood chips, bark, straw, shredded leaves | |||
Inorganic Mulch | Walkways, under decks, rock gardens | Long-lasting, doesn’t decompose | No soil enrichment benefits |
e.g. rubber, landscape fabric, stones |
How to Mulch Like a Pro (Step-by-Step)
Want professional results? Follow these simple steps:
1️⃣ Clean the area first – Remove weeds, old mulch, and debris
2️⃣ Edge your garden beds – Sharp edges keep mulch from spilling into lawns or walkways
3️⃣ Water the soil (lightly) – Moisture helps activate mulch benefits
4️⃣ Apply mulch 2–3 inches deep – Too thin = weeds sneak through; too thick = roots may suffocate
5️⃣ Keep mulch away from plant stems and tree trunks – Leave a 1–2 inch gap to prevent rot and pests
Common Mulching Mistakes to Avoid
🚫 Volcano mulching: Piling mulch against tree trunks causes rot and insect damage
🚫 Over-mulching: More than 3 inches can suffocate roots and prevent water from penetrating
🚫 Using the wrong mulch type: Avoid dyed mulch near edibles or lightweight mulch in windy areas
